摘  要:Naturally occurring interleukin-2(IL-2)is a pleiotropic glycoprotein that regulates immune responses by controlling the differentia-tion and homeostasis of T cells.Non-glycosylated IL-2 has been used in clinical settings for three decades.However,the function of the O-glycan of native IL-2 remains elusive.Herein,to stress this issue,we report a highly efficient semi-synthesis of homogeneous glycosylated IL-2 with various glycoproteoforms on a multi-milligram scale.The glycopeptide fragment was prepared by chemical synthesis and then merged with recombinant fragment via a serine ligation to generate the desired glycoprotein in a single opera-tion.Biological evaluation of the homogenous glycoprotein library reveals that the activity of IL-2 in activating individual T cell subset is glycan dependent,thus highlighting the possibility of further improving current clinical medicine.
